Voids In Between Teeth



To deal with the concern of congestion, another typical orthodontic problem occurs: voids between your teeth. Spaces between teeth, additionally referred to as diastemas, can take place for different factors.

One usual cause is a discrepancy in the size of the teeth and the jawbone. Attack Issues



Correcting bite problems is crucial for correct placement and feature of your teeth. If you're experiencing bite problems, it's important to seek orthodontic treatment to address the problem.

Below are 3 usual bite problems and just how they can be dealt with:

1. Overbite: An overbite takes place when your top front teeth overlap dramatically with your lower front teeth. This can bring about troubles with biting and eating. Orthodontic treatment, such as dental braces or Invisalign, can assist fix an overbite by progressively moving the teeth right into their correct position.

2. Underbite: An underbite is when your lower front teeth extend before your top teeth. This can impact the appearance of your smile and can trigger troubles with biting and eating. Orthodontic therapy might include using braces or other devices to move the reduced teeth back and align them effectively with the upper teeth.

3. Crossbite: A crossbite is when your upper teeth sit inside your reduced teeth when you bite down. This can cause unequal endure the teeth and can bring about jaw discomfort. Orthodontic treatment for a crossbite may involve using dental braces or various other devices to realign the teeth and deal with the bite.

Misaligned Jaw



If you have a misaligned jaw, orthodontic treatment can assist realign it for boosted bite and jaw feature. A misaligned jaw takes place when the top and reduced jaws don't meet properly. This can result in numerous problems, such as difficulty eating, speaking, and even breathing.

Orthodontists can use different methods to fix a misaligned jaw, depending on the seriousness of the problem. One typical method is making use of dental braces or aligners to gradually shift the position of the teeth and align the jaws. In extra severe instances, orthognathic surgical procedure might be essential to reposition the jawbones and attain proper placement.

It is very important to speak with an orthodontist to determine the best treatment prepare for your misaligned jaw.
